The Auditor Intern will support the Audit department and develop audit skills during mandated and risk-based audits. Duties will include:
Assist with the planning, coordination, and execution of internal audits and reviews to evaluate internal control design, implementation and operating effectiveness.
Create/update documentation of internal controls.
Perform detail testing for internal audits and the Annual Financial Reporting Model Regulation (AFRMR) project to ensure completion of the departmental audit plan.
Communicate risks and deficiencies to management by successfully communicating audit recommendations.
Required Qualifications:
Degree program(s) / Current Status: junior or senior level undergraduate, Master’s level or recent graduate in Accounting, Finance or Information Technology related fields. Preferred: Internal Audit Specialization
Cumulative GPA: 3.0 GPA preferred; minimum cumulative 2.5 GPA.
Relevant Coursework: Audit coursework and/or experience is strongly preferred.
Other Qualifications:
Must have working knowledge of Microsoft Office suite (Word, Excel, and PowerPoint). Knowledge of Microsoft Access or other IT tools is a plus.
Must demonstrate effective oral and written communication abilities
Must demonstrate the ability to think analytically and present ideas professionally
Self-motivated, adaptable to a changing work environment and team-oriented.
Undergraduates must be able to work 20 hours per week during the spring and fall semesters and 30-35 hours per week during the summer.

Blue Cross and Blue Shield of Louisiana performs background and pre-employment drug screening after an offer has been extended and prior to hire for all positions. As part of this process records may be verified and information checked with agencies including but not limited to the Social Security Administration, criminal courts, federal, state, and county repositories of criminal records, Department of Motor Vehicles and credit bureaus. Pursuant with sec 1033 of the Violent Crime Control and Law Enforcement Act of 1994, individuals who have been convicted of a felony crime involving dishonesty or breach of trust are prohibited from working in the insurance industry unless they obtain written consent from their state insurance commissioner.
Additionally, Blue Cross and Blue Shield of Louisiana is a Drug Free Workplace. A pre-employment drug screen will be required and any offer is contingent upon satisfactory drug testing results.
